CHARLES BROAD, Resident Mugistiate ana Warden. TELSON CREEK WATEB -* RACE. Public Works Office, Wellington, October 28, 1873. WRITTEN TENDERS will be re. ceived at this office up to NOON on WEDNESDAY, 10th DECEMBER, for the construction of a portion of the above Race in FOUR SECTIONS, being altogether about 16 ; V miles. They must be addressed to the Hon. the Minister for Public Works, Wellington, and marked <<utside " Tender Nelson Creek Water Race." Plans and specifications may be scon at this office on and after Monday, 10th Novembar, and at the Public Works Office, Grey mouth, on the arrival of the first mail after that date. Telegraphic tenders, similarly addressed and marked, will be received if presented at any Telegraph Office by NOONof the same date, provided that written tenders in due form are lodged at a District Engineer's Office by the same hour. Tenders may be sent in for ONE or MORE sections; but the lowest or any tender will not necessarily be accepted. By Command. JOHN BLACKETT, Assistant En<*ineer-in-Chief. v - Usgs& R.
